Other Considerations for the Parent/Child Model
The parent/child model does not allow the child Unified CCE systems to use a local CVP at the child 
level. Only the parent can use CVP to perform network queuing across the entire system. Multi-channel 
components such as Cisco Email Manager or Web Collaboration and Unified Outbound Option may be 
installed only at the child Unified CCE level, not at the parent. They are treated as nodal implementations 
on a site-by-site basis.
Other Considerations for High Availability
A Unified CCE failover can affect other parts of the solution. Although Unified CCE may stay up and 
running, some data could be lost during its failover, or other products that depend on Unified CCE to 
function properly might not be able to handle a Unified CCE failover. This section examines what 
happens to other critical areas in the Unified CCE solution during and after failover.
Reporting
The Unified CCE reporting feature uses real-time, five-minute and half-hour intervals to build its 
reporting database. Therefore, at the end of each five-minute and half-hour interval, each Peripheral 
Gateway will gather the data it has kept locally and send it to the Call Routers. The Call Routers process 
the data and send it to their local Logger and Database Servers for historical data storage. If the 
deployment has the Historical Data Server (HDS) option, that data is then replicated to the HDS from 
the Logger as it is written to the Logger database.
The Peripheral Gateways provide buffering (in memory and on disk) of the five-minute and half-hour 
data collected by the system to handle network connectivity failures or slow network response as well 
as automatic retransmission of data when the network service is restored. However, physical failure of 
both Peripheral Gateways in a redundant pair can result in loss of the half-hour or five-minute data that 
has not been transmitted to the Central Controller. Cisco recommends the use of redundant Peripheral 
Gateways to reduce the chance of losing both physical hardware devices and their associated data during 
an outage window.
When agents log out, all their reporting statistics stop. The next time the agents log in, their real-time 
statistics start from zero. Typically, Unified ICM failover does not force the agents to log out; however, 
it does reset their agent statistics when the Unified ICM failover is complete, but their agent desktop 
functionality is restored back to its pre-failover state.
